Highlights
- Beavercreek spends 4.1% less per student than Thornton.
- The Student Teacher Ratio is 14.1% higher in Beavercreek than in Thornton. (lower means fewer students in each classroom).
- Beavercreek had 10.6% more residents who had graduated High School compared to Thornton
